Job Summary:
Reporting to the Project Manager, the incumbent will provide confidential administrative assistance and support to the Project Manager and assist with overall effectiveness of day-to-day admin operations with the objective of ensuring effective and efficient workflow.

Job Summary

  • Type: full-time
  • Location: Ghanzi
  • Category: Administrative
  • Closing Date: 2026-07-03

Key Responsibilities

  • To provide secretarial and administrative assistance to the Project Manager (including maintenance / management of the managers personal schedule, travel arrangements etc.) in order to effectively manage the Project Manager’s time
  • To administer Company travel including managing travel and hotel agent relationships in order to ensure the best possible rates are secured
  • To manage in-coming and outgoing correspondence and administrative data, including file indices and document control systems in order to ensure accessibility and accuracy of all information
  • To ensure all phone calls and visitors are attended to promptly and politely in order to provide a positive and courteous interface with internal and external clients.
  • To maintain Project contact database in order to provide Project Manager and other members with accurate contact information
  • To administer the office stationery, housekeeping and food / beverage supply requirements and maintain a record of stocks in order to ensure that such supplies are constantly replenished as required.
  • Address general accommodation queries and requests
  • To assist with the facilities functions from time to time

Requirements

  • Professional certificate or diploma in secretarial studies
  • 5 to 8 years’ experience in a mining environment
  • Class B driver’s license
  • Knowledge of MS Office
  • Good skills with PowerPoint

Frequently Asked Questions

What typical qualifications or education are needed to become a Project Secretary in Botswana?

Most Project Secretary roles in Botswana typically require a Botswana General Certificate of Secondary Education (BGCSE) and a relevant secretarial or business administration diploma or certificate. Employers often look for candidates with proven experience in an administrative or project support role, demonstrating strong organizational and communication skills.

What are the common day-to-day responsibilities of a Project Secretary, especially in a project-focused company?

A Project Secretary manages project documentation, schedules meetings, and handles correspondence to ensure smooth project operations. This includes maintaining filing systems, assisting with report preparation, and supporting project managers and teams in a dynamic project-driven environment.

What is the typical work culture and what are the expectations for a Project Secretary in Botswana's corporate environment?

The work culture in Botswana often emphasizes professionalism, respect for hierarchy, and strong interpersonal relationships. Project Secretaries are expected to be punctual, highly organized, and proactive, demonstrating a collaborative spirit and commitment to supporting project goals effectively.

What are the realistic career progression or growth paths for a Project Secretary in Botswana?

A Project Secretary can typically progress to roles such as Senior Project Secretary, Administrative Officer, or even a Project Administrator. Further development might include specializing in project coordination or management with additional qualifications and experience.

What kind of benefits, like leave or medical aid, can a Project Secretary typically expect from employers in Botswana?

Full-time Project Secretaries in Botswana typically receive benefits such as annual leave, sick leave, and often contributions to a medical aid scheme. Many employers also provide a pension fund, adhering to local labour laws and industry standards for employee welfare.

What do employers in Botswana look for when hiring a Project Secretary and what's the typical application process?

Employers in Botswana look for strong organizational skills, proficiency in office software, and excellent communication abilities in both English and Setswana. The application process usually involves submitting a detailed CV and cover letter, followed by interviews and sometimes a practical skills assessment.
